Women of Influence

The International Women’s Day is observed the world over to mark women’s struggle for justice, their triumphs and tribulations. “Women’s Empowerment” is therefore the buzzword today. To some, it may mean the disempowerment of men! But it should not be so. A healthy balance of male / female responsibilities and relationships need to be maintained for the building of a happy community.

This issue celebrates women by highlighting the profiles of five ordinary women, who with grit and determination have used their skills to make innovative and extraordinary contribution to various interests of our nation.

However we recognize that only a small percentage of our women have been able to overcome odds and rise to make their mark in our society. We do not overlook the tragic plight of vast majority of our women. Therefore, in this issue, we are also bringing the life story of one young woman, Anna, highlighting marital woes that many helpless women face. We cannot just sit back and read it without being moved to action. It is pointless for us to bemoan our lot without being stirred to do something. Let it not be said of our generation that we are working only for our own selfish well-being and interests. May we be known as women who have courage for the well-being of other women in distress too.

This issue also highlights our concern for the future generation – our youth today. By and large we must confess that we have become so driven in pursuing the promotion of our own careers and interests that we are in danger of sacrificing our family’s happiness and the building of children under our responsibility. We find marriages on the rocks and youth devastated. This year what changes are we prepared to make – even sacrificially – to reverse this destructive process?

This International Women’s Day should not be just a celebration for the Day, but a year-long commitment for the betterment of not just a few – but of the majority of our women. We may be just one person. We may be ordinary women. But in our own circles let us influence those we touch for good, by our encouragement of the down-hearted, the strengthening of the weak and challenging ourselves and others to rise above problems and circumstances to make a difference where we are.
